The Role

Mullen Plumbing is seeking a Plumbing Service Technician to safely diagnose, install, and repair plumbing systems in both residential and some commercial settings that effectively lead customers to informed and confident buying decisions.

Primary Duties/Responsibilities of Role

  • Install pipes, drainage systems, sinks, toilets, complete drain cleaning as well as other Plumbing related in-home services
  • Effectively handle a variety of Plumbing emergencies efficiently and professionally
  • Test systems for leaks and properly diagnose other Plumbing problems.
  • Be clean and thorough in performing inspections and provide accurate advice to homeowners, including use of shoe covers or other protective equipment to keep the customer’s home clean.
  • Understand service criteria and hold yourself accountable for meeting and/or exceeding revenue goals.
  • Partner with Call Center and Dispatch to ensure the business's overall success.
  • Maintain a clean, organized job site and well-inventoried truck.
  • Debrief with the Dispatcher after every completed job to ensure proper invoicing, documentation, and uploading of job photos into Service Titan.
  • Actively participate in scheduled trainings, meetings, and other development opportunities to continue professional growth.
  • Train and mentor apprentices to ensure timely, accurate repairs and installations.
  • Be detailed, accurate, and timely with invoices, timecards, feedback, and option sheets.
  • Expand opportunities to covert jobs by educating and providing customers with options and helping them choose the best financing options and maintenance plans.
